About Zhangying Ye

Zhangying Ye is a scholar working on Aquatic Science, Water Science and Technology and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ering, having authored 120 papers that have together received 2.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Aquaculture Nutrition and Growth (27 papers), Water Quality Monitoring Technologies (27 papers) and Aquaculture disease management and microbiota (21 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Aquatic Science (610 citations), Water Science and Technology (740 citations) and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ering (435 citations). Zhangying Ye has collaborated with scholars based in China, Netherlands and Nigeria. Frequent co-authors include Songming Zhu, Dezhao Liu, Jian Zhao, Gang Liu, Songming Zhu, Yale Deng, Abubakar Shitu, Musa Abubakar Tadda, Zhiying Han and Yadong Zhang. Their work appears in journals such as The Science of The Total Environment, Bioresource Technology and Journal of Cleaner Production.
